A Strategic Performance Management Solution

IMPACT is a cloud-based platform developed by Spider Strategies Inc., to help organizations execute their strategy and achieve their goals in any industry and size. IMPACT helps organizations manage, measure, and optimize business performance using data visualization, team alignment, communication, and initiative management. IMPACT can work with any performance management methodology, such as Balanced Scorecard, OKRs, KPIs, Earned Value Management, and more. IMPACT also provides features such as assistance and note-taking for leadership review meetings, assigning tasks, customizable dashboards, strategy maps, scorecards, reports, initiatives tracking, collaboration tools, data governance and security, and more.

IMPACT is a solution from Spider Strategies of USA, and we are their channel partners for Asia.

Balanced Scorecard Engagement

Balanced Scorecard for Strategy Execution
No. of Balanced Scorecard built in IMPACT
No. of Objectives built-in IMPACT Scorecard
No. of People trained on IMPACT
Clients served in countries in Asia for IMPACT